Helen of Troy Completes Acquisition of Hydro Flask®

EL PASO, Texas–(BUSINESS WIRE)–Helen of Troy Limited (NASDAQ, NM:HELE), designer, developer and
worldwide marketer of consumer brand-name housewares, health and home,
nutritional supplement and beauty products, announced that it has closed
its previously-announced acquisition of Steel Technology, LLC., which
does business under the brand name Hydro Flask, for approximately $210
million in cash, subject to certain customary closing adjustments. The
purchase price implies a pre-synergy multiple of less than 12 times
projected calendar year 2016 adjusted EBITDA. Hydro Flask is a leading
designer, distributor and marketer of high performance insulated
hydration vessels for active lifestyles.

Mininberg continued “We are delighted to welcome the Hydro Flask team to
our family. Hydro Flask is a compelling strategic fit and the first
acquired brand in our Housewares segment since purchasing OXO in 2004.
The Hydro Flask team will continue to be based in Bend, Oregon where we
can preserve the qualities we admire. Hydro Flask will report into our
Housewares business, where they can leverage their proven expertise in
product design and category development, as well as our own. We expect
to add further value through Helen of Troy’s shared services, larger
infrastructure, and international footprint. We believe we can
capitalize on the compelling trends in Hydro Flask’s product category
and adjacencies and create value for consumers, customers and our
shareholders.

Adjusted EBITDA is considered a non-GAAP financial measure. Adjusted
EBITDA is defined as ear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ation,
amortization, non-cash asset impairment charges, acquisition-related
expenses, CEO succession costs, non-cash share based compensation and
intangible asset amortization expense, as applicable.
